Transaction

121a4506c7ec6bcffb0687bc274d510c042e8f0a2eaa0513dbe79a1db430702a
289,751 confirmations
Timestamp
1598519106
Block645,533
Fee19,012 sats
Fee rate43.2 sats/vB
view on mempool.space

Inputs & Outputs